My daughter was diagnosed at 8 with a bad case of mono -(my post below said 10 but I remember now that she was 8)- we actually had to take her out of school and home-school her for the remainder of 2nd grade because she had so many absences due to fevera and fatigue. We even took her to a neuroligist at one point because of severe, recurrent headaches. It took her about a year to get back to normal. Now I wonder about a "double whammy" for her in regard to increased risk because of my BC, and the link between EBV and invasive BC.
I hope to stay on top of the research being done now, which has been brought to our attention by Lyn. If anyone comes across any pertinent articles, please be sure and post them!
